Bit Trendy, Bit Fit - FitBit!



Fitbit has gone trendy with three new style statements namely Charge, Charge HR and Surge. Apart from having a sleek design, the new wearables also possess attractive features. Also, they will keep you on your toes by tracking your fitness record. Here are their features:

Fitbit Charge:
  • Accurate tracking of steps taken, distance travelled, calories burned and floors climbed
  • An OLED display showing time and real-time stats
  • Automatic sleep detection monitors sleep quality using motion analysis to understand your sleep pattern and waking up time; also features a silent, vibrating alarm
  • Caller ID to helps users stay connected to incoming calls
  • Exercise tracking to easily record workouts, see real-time exercise stats and have summaries appear automatically on the Fitbit dashboard
  • A high-quality, water-resistant, comfortable new textured wristband design with an improved clasp
  • Up to 7 days of battery life


Fitbit Charge HR 
It includes all the great benefits of Charge, plus:
  • Continuous heart rate to keep an eye on calorie burnt, reach target workout intensity and maximize training
  • All-day insights into overall heart health including resting heart rate and heart rate trends, alongside stats like steps, distance, floors climbed, calories and active minutes
  • Up to 5 days of battery life


Fitbit Surge 
It includes all the features of Charge and Charge HR, plus:
  • Built-in GPS delivers stats like pace, distance, elevation, split times, route history and workout summaries for smarter training
  • Records multi-sport activities like running, cross-training and strength workouts; see comprehensive summaries with tailored metrics, workout intensity and calories burned
  • Smartwatch features including Caller ID, text alerts and mobile music control let users train smarter and stay focused right from the wrist
  • Eight sensors—3-axis accelerometers, gyroscope, compass, ambient light sensor, GPS and heart rate—working harmoniously to give users the most advanced tracking in the thinnest, lightest design on the market
  • Backlit LCD touch screen display with customizable watch faces makes it easy to navigate through real-time stats, workout apps, sleep and alarms
  • Up to 7 days of battery life
